The role of Swahili in unifying the people of Tanzania to work for independence guaranteed it prestige and positive attitudes. The charisma of Nyerere himself carried over to the language he used extensively in his speeches and his political writings.People have often seen the success of Swahili as the national language in Tanzania as due to its’ neutral status –it is not identified with a particular tribe. But its widespread acceptance was also due to the fact that Tanzanians developed a strong loyalty towards the language which united them in working towards uhuru.But finally it is important to remember that the story of how Swahili became the national language of Tanzania might be told rather difference by a group whose tribal vernacular was a competing lingua franca
